Overview

An amazing job opportunity has arisen for a committed Registered General Nurse to work in an exceptional care home based in the Armagh, Northern Ireland area. You will be working for one of UK's leading health care providers. This care home has been developed to provide care for adults with learning disabilities, autism and complex physical disabilities.

To be considered for this position you must be qualified as a Registered Nurse (RGN) with a current active NMC Pin.

Responsibilities
  • Ensure the highest possible standards of care, assessing residents\' needs and wishes, and developing services to enhance their quality of life
  • Champion appropriate independence and personal choice; developing, reviewing and updating care plans to meet our residents physical, social and psychological needs
  • Oversee all aspects of medicine management on your shift – ensuring medicines are appropriately received, stored and administered, in accordance with company policies and current legislation
  • Build the positive reputation of the Business; liaise professionally with visitors and other external stakeholders
  • Ensure compliance with all legal, regulatory and best practice guidelines – identify, investigate and resolve risks proactively
  • Support, guide, teach and mentor others in line with the NMC Code, following its guidance at all times
Skills and experience (preferred)
  • Knowledge and experience with administering medication safely
  • Be confident in creating and updating individualised care plans and documentation
  • Deliver hands on nursing care to ensure the well-being and health of our residents
  • Have an excellent understanding of the standards set by CQC
